Abstract

The objective assigned to this project is the development of a method for determination of the influence of raw sand physico-chemical characteristics on the production yield of the liquid sodium silicate. Three kinds of raw sand (SIG, GOR, ARICHA), which differ each other by chemical composition, have been studied for different particules sizes. The influence of temperature and reaction time, system used, and molar ratios of different reagents have been determined. The study done show that the raw sand ‘ARICHA’ of particules size (63 – 45) microns gave the best results. The temperature is 200°C and the reaction time is 40 minutes. The reaction conversion is 94%. The kind ‘SIG’ of particules size (75 – 63) microns is the best choice to obtain a liquid sodium silicate of properties that reply the glass industries conditions.
